> On Tue, 19 Feb 2008, Marcel Holtmann wrote:
> > I don't really have any idea. Nothing has been changed in this area for a
> > couple of years. The command TX timeout is the timeout that indicates a
> > missing answer to a command sent down to the Bluetooth chip.
> >
> > However this involves some atomic and tasklet stuff. Did we have some changes
> > that I missed and might now render this usage as broken.
>
> Not that I'm aware off, but this might as well be some old use after
> free bug which got exposed by some unrelated change. The good news is
> that it is reproducible. I'll hack up some nasty debug patch which
> lets us - hopefully - decode where the timer was armed.
